8.1 Overview of the Process

Oracle Financial Services Asset Liability Management (OFS ALM) is designed to model balance sheets under a variety of rate environments. OFS ALM functionality uses several key concepts and has evolved from the continual iterations of building simulated management processes. The basis of OFS ALM functionality includes:

  • The ability to model account-level detail to precisely capture the complex product characteristics within a financial institution'sportfolios.
  • A flexible time horizon and free-form timing bucket increments for reporting are critical to meet the wide range of forecasting requirements of financialinstitutions.
  • An unconstrained chart of account definition is a basic requirement of effectivemodeling.
  • A structured process for defining and controlling assumptions is critical to anysuccessful modeling process.
  • An unconstrained batching of scenarios, with flexible assumptions sets, is required to achievean effective and efficient analytical process.
